We introduce VGA-BenchV2, an extended human-aligned benchmark and optimization framework for jointly evaluating and improving video generation quality and aesthetic value. Built upon VGA-Bench, VGA-Be...
AI video generation has advanced rapidly and entered widespread commercial use. As a result, quality differences among videos produced by state-of-the-art AI video generation models~(AIVGMs) have become increasingly difficult to discern using conventional evaluation criteria, such as visual fidelity and semantic instruction following.
